Foggy Window Restoration: A Comprehensive Guide
Foggy windows can be an aggravating concern for property owners, obscuring exposure and detracting from the total aesthetic appearance of a property. The problem emerges when moisture gets caught in between the panes of double or triple-glazed windows, causing condensation and fogging. Comprehending the Causes of Foggy Windows
Fogging typically indicates that the window seal has failed, permitting moisture to infiltrate the insulating space between the panes. A variety of elements can contribute to the foggy window phenomenon, including:
Temperature Fluctuations: Wide variations in temperature can worry window seals, resulting in fractures.Aging of Materials: Over time, seals can degrade due to direct exposure to sunlight, humidity, and temperature modifications.Poor Installation: Improperly installed windows might not seal properly, making them more prone to fogging.Ecological Factors: High humidity levels can exacerbate condensation within windows, specifically in coastal or rainy areas.Restoration Methods for Foggy Windows
Fortunately, foggy windows don't necessarily require total replacement. Here are some effective restoration approaches that property owners can consider:
1. Do it yourself Solutions
For those looking to take on foggy windows without a professional, certain DIY methods can often supply temporary relief:
Defogging Kits: Many home improvement stores offer defogging sets that consist of cleaning up solutions and tools to get rid of condensation. These sets frequently require drilling little holes in the window frame for application.Desiccants: Silica gel packets or other desiccant materials can be put in the window frame to soak up moisture.
Keep in mind: These techniques might only supply a momentary service and do not fix the underlying problem of the failed seal.
2. Professional Restoration Services
For a more permanent fix, homeowners may wish to consider working with professionals who specialize in window restoration. Solutions might consist of:
Seal Replacement: Professionals can replace the insulating seal in between the panes, efficiently restoring the window's original condition.Glass Replacement: If the glass itself is damaged or the window is beyond repair, replacing the entire pane might be essential.Full Window Replacement: In severe cases, complete window replacement might be the only alternative.Service TypeDescriptionCost Range (Approx.)DIY Defogging KitsMomentary at-home solutions₤ 20 - ₤ 100Seal ReplacementProfessional seal restoration₤ 100 - ₤ 300 per windowGlass ReplacementReplacement of foggy panes₤ 200 - ₤ 500 per paneFull Window ReplacementComplete replacement of the window₤ 500 - ₤ 1,200 per windowPreventative Measures
After bring back foggy windows, property owners must take steps to prevent the problem from recurring. Here are some methods to consider:
Invest in Quality Installations: Ensure that windows are installed by qualified specialists to lessen the threat of seal failure.
Regular Maintenance: Conduct routine examinations of window seals and frames for signs of wear and tear.
Control Indoor Humidity: Use dehumidifiers and ensure proper ventilation in damp areas like bathroom and kitchens to reduce humidity levels inside the home.
Use Window Treatments: Thermal window coverings can assist to control temperature level distinctions in between the inside and beyond windows, lowering the probability of condensation.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: Can foggy windows be repaired?A: Yes, foggy windows can frequently be restored through professional services that change seals or panes, or through DIY solutions for temporary relief. Q2: How long do window seals typically last?A: Window seals typically last in between 10 to 20 years, however their life expectancy can vary based upon ecological conditions and window quality. Q3: Is it worth repairing foggy windows?A: It typically depends on the degree of the fogging and the condition of the windows.
